The origins of dandiya can be
traced back to ancient times when it was performed as a devotional dance in
honor of the Hindu
goddess Durga or Amba. The traditional folk dance is to date a Bliss to
perform and watch. The Soul of Dandia is a remarkable effort made by Ranjit
Sarkar to capture the essence of Dandiya in his art form. The piece holds astounding imagery of woman Rajasthani woman in a radiant Lehenga-choli
carrying the pride of performing her Folk Dance,
dandiya in her raptured eyes.
